TOPIC:
Find out how to prosper in the future by using your current appraisal skills as a base. In these uncertain economic times, learn about the transferable skills you already have to create a more diverse and rewarding career path. Also learn about a recent California court decision which should substantially increase demand for residential appraisals.
SPEAKER:
Tom Kenster, Realty Educator, Economist, Counselor and Principal in Kenster Realty Legal Advisors. Tom Kenster received a BS degree from USC as the first national real estate scholarship recipient and graduated from the MBA program at StanfordSouthwesternUniversityLawSchool. Tom has testified regarding real property litigation on well over 100 occasions and has presented almost 1,000 real property lectures nationally and internationally. He has 25 years as faculty at UCLA, UC-Irvine and USC where he organized and instructed the AI master degree program.
